EasyMarkets provides a proprietary web-based platform that is intuitive and great for beginners, with features like dealCancellation (allowing traders to cancel a losing trade for a fee) and guaranteed stop-loss orders. It is fully browser-based, with no download required. HotForex HFM offers industry-standard platforms: MetaTrader 4, MetaTrader 5, and cTrader, along with a mobile app. For Irish traders, MT4/MT5 provide advanced charting, automated trading via Expert Advisors (EAs), and a wide range of indicators. cTrader is particularly favoured for its depth of market and fast execution. If you rely on custom indicators or algorithmic strategies, HotForex is the better platform. For simplicity and ease of use, EasyMarkets may suffice.

Regulation is a key consideration for Irish traders. EasyMarkets is regulated by CySEC (Cyprus) and adheres to ESMA rules, including leverage caps of 30:1 for major forex pairs and mandatory negative balance protection. This offers a high level of security for retail clients. HotForex HFM is regulated by the FSA in St. Vincent and the Grenadines, which is a less strict regime, and also holds licences from the FSC in Mauritius and the FCA in the UK (for certain subsidiaries). However, note that HotForex’s international entity may not offer the same investor protection as EU-regulated brokers. Irish traders who prioritise regulatory safety may prefer EasyMarkets, while those comfortable with offshore regulation may benefit from lower costs at HotForex. Neither broker is directly authorised by the Central Bank of Ireland.

For Muslim traders in Ireland who require swap-free (Islamic) accounts, both EasyMarkets and HotForex HFM offer solutions. EasyMarkets provides Islamic accounts without any time limit on open positions, meaning you can hold trades overnight indefinitely without incurring rollover interest. HotForex HFM also offers Islamic accounts but imposes a maximum holding period (commonly 10 days), after which a swap fee may apply if the position remains open. Irish traders following Sharia law should examine these differences carefully. EasyMarkets’ policy is more accommodating for long-term traders, while HotForex’s terms may suit shorter-term strategies. Both brokers require a simple request to activate the swap-free status, subject to eligibility.
